SOLO, Indonesia — Police hunting for suspects in Jakarta hotel bombings raided a hide-out in central Indonesia, sparking gunfire and an explosion Thursday that left four suspected militants dead, officials said. Three alleged terrorists also were captured.
A counterterrorism official said the dead included alleged bomb-maker Bagus Budi Pranato. The captured militants included a pregnant woman who was being treated at a hospital, national police spokesman Nanan Sukarna said.
Police tracked the seven suspects to the town of Solo in Central Java and besieged a village house on the outskirts overnight. The raid ended near daybreak when an explosion was detonated inside the home, the spokesman said.
The operation left behind a charred house with no roof and blown-out walls. The bodies were flown to Jakarta for autopsies.
Broadcaster TVOne speculated that an unidentified body was that of Noordin Muhammad Top, the region's most wanted militant, but there was no confirmation and his death has erroneously been reported before.
Large quantities of explosives, weapons, grenades and bombs were recovered from the scene as ambulances shuttled away the dead and injured.
